Paige Hookway

Managing Editor
Paige Hookway is the Managing Editor of Procurement Pro, where she brings over a decade of industry experience to shaping insightful, engaging, and forward-thinking content for the global electronics community. After graduating from the University of Greenwich with a 2:1 in English Literature, Paige blended her love of storytelling with a deep curiosity for technology – carving out a career that champions both innovation and the people behind it. Across her 10+ years in the sector, Paige has developed a strong reputation for uncovering emerging trends, translating complex concepts into accessible insights, and spotlighting the voices shaping the future of engineering. She is particularly passionate about encouraging the next generation of engineers and elevating women in tech narratives that inspire, empower, and drive meaningful change.
